What Does Cruciferous Mean?

Cruciferous is defined as a plant or vegetable that belongs to the Cruciferae family of plants. Cruciferous vegetables are known as the wonder kids of the vegetable world. Some varieties of cruciferous vegetables include cabbage, bok choy, collards, broccoli, Brussels sprouts, kohlrabi, kale, mustard greens, turnip greens and cauliflower.

Cruciferous vegetables contain more phytochemicals than other groups of vegetables. Phytochemicals are those chemicals whose main function is to strengthen the immune system. In other words, foods which are rich in phytochemicals must be included in the diet in larger quantities. This not only makes the diet look a lot more balanced, but also helps the body to increase resistance against diseases and viral ailments more than any other known variety of foods.

Cruciferous vegetables are those vegetables which are rich in the vitamins C, E and beta-carotene. These vitamins have antioxidant properties. They are a good source of fibre, which is an essential nutrient.
